We picked this 15 day from Long Beach, California to Hawaii so we didn't have to fly to Honolulu. Third time on the Miracle and it's better than ever. So many great places to relax and enjoy sea days. Service was the best of our 15 cruises! Nick and Nora's Steakhouse was wonderful and the dining room service from Eva and Zodar was superb! While we're both port people, this was the best it could have been with 8 sea days. Our cabin steward Emmanuel and Putu were the very best we could ask for. Coffee Bar on deck 2 was the best. This class of ships is the most comfortable for Journey's Cruising. Plenty of options for activities and for relaxing and playing cards or reading.

Weather required that we miss 2 ports (Hilo and Kauai), which resulted in 2 day stays in Honolulu and Kona. Two perfect ports to be in for an extra day. Kona has tons of shopping and great restaurants within walking distance with some cultural sites as well. Honolulu of course has Pearl Harbor and a city tour, both great! And excellent shopping in downtown Waikiki.

Ensenada

Enjoyed a sidewalk restaurant in town. The poverty in this city is overwhelming. So, be prepared to politely say no thank you often. Good bargains on leather goods too.
